Overview

This episode of "Doin' Time With The Sheriff" delves into significant updates concerning the Pitkin County community. It begins with an overview of a recent robbery on Smuggler Mountain Road, highlighting local law enforcement's swift response and offering listeners safety advice. The bulk of the episode focuses on the jail planning process, exploring various aspects such as financial considerations, the need for a new facility, community impact, and the emphasis on rehabilitation and prevention programs. The discussion underscores the importance of community safety, fiscal responsibility, and proactive approaches to law enforcement and public safety.

List of Episode Speakers


Alex Burchetta - Undersheriff at the Pitkin County Sheriff's Office, host of the episode.
Sheriff Bugilone - Participates in the discussion on the jail planning process.
Dan Fellin - Jail division chief, discusses the jail planning process and community programs.
Parker Lathrop - Chief Deputy of Operations, provides updates on the Smuggler Mountain Road robbery.


Timestamps & Content Overview


0:00-0:24 - Introduction by Alex Burchetta, Undersheriff at the Pitkin County Sheriff's Office. Announcement of episode topics: jail planning process and the recent robbery on Smuggler Mountain Road.
0:24-3:51—Discussion on the recent robbery reported on Smuggler Mountain Road. Speakers include the Sheriff, Parker Lathrop (Chief Deputy of Operations), and Alex Burchetta. They provide details of the incident, the authorities' response, and safety advice for the community.
3:51-11:52 - Conversation about the jail planning process with Sheriff Buglione and Jail Division Chief Dan Fellin. Discussion includes the status of the jail planning, options being considered, financial considerations, and the focus on community and rehabilitation programs.
